Hello!
It's coming up on election time for the board of PostgreSQL Europe,
and we need some help. There are actually no rules set for how such an
election should be held, who should vote, how votes should be tallied,
etc. There are some ideas, but no rules set down.
So we need a working group to set up such rules, and we need this done
fairly quickly. To keep this from turning into bikeshedding, we'd like
to set up this working group and have them work together - not on the
open mailinglist - to deliver a complete proposal. But we certainly
don't want this working group to just be the pgeu board. Thus, we need
volunteers.
We have appointed Andreas 'ads' Scherbaum to head up this working
group. We would also like at least two volunteers that are *not* on
the board to help us with this. So if you are interested, or if you
have a suggestion on whom to bring in, please let us know.
And again, we're working on a tight schedule to get this all done (we
hope to hold the elections sometime around FOSDEM in february), so
please let us know ASAP.
